Comprehending A4 Paper
A4 paper determines 210 × 297 mm (8.27 × 11.69 inches) and belongs to the ISO 216 standard specifying paper sizes. It is primarily used for files, reports, and letters, making it a basic resource throughout various fields.

The supply chain for A4 paper generally consists of:
Raw Material Sourcing: This includes the procurement of wood pulp or recycled paper.
Production: The raw products are processed at mills to produce sheets of A4 paper.
Circulation: Finished items are then distributed to wholesalers and sellers.
End Users: Finally, customers, schools, and services purchase and make use of A4 Paper Rolls paper.

Raw Material Availability: The supply of A4 paper is closely connected to the accessibility of wood pulp. Environmental regulations and sustainable forestry practices can affect this supply.
Technological Changes: The rise of digital interaction has actually reduced the need for printed documents, affecting production levels.
Financial Conditions: Fluctuations in the global economy impact customer purchasing behavior and can result in modifications in demand for paper products.
Ecological Concerns: Increased awareness of sustainability has actually led lots of companies to embrace eco-friendly practices, which can impact supply chains.

Q2: How can I ensure that I'm buying sustainably sourced A4 paper?
A2: Look for certifications such as FSC (Forest Stewardship Council) or PEFC (Programme for the Endorsement of Forest Certification) on paper items, suggesting sustainable sourcing practices.
